Publisher's Synopsis

Ransom Barton and his wife, Claire de Murrow, have arrived in Legault to reclaim the title that was Claire's birthright. Claire intends to rebuild a war-ravaged palace to its former glory and to teach Ransom about the magical history of their new home. But when Ransom is summoned to return to King Benedict, his loyalty to Claire is tested. Fealty prevails, however questionable the king's motives. The ambitious Benedict, who controls his late father's dominion, must prove his might. The warriors of the East Kingdoms have disrupted the trade routes, weakening every kingdom in their path. Benedict's plan is to fend off a coming war through strategic alliances. But it's Ransom's post to keep the king's allies - as well as his poisonous enemies - in line, even as Benedict's defense may be inviting further chaos.
